Driver Side Power Window does not Operate with Power Window Master Switch: Description
When the engine is running or the ignition switch is ON, the driver door power window regulator motor is driven by operating the power window regulator master switch. The driver door power window regulator motor has motor, regulator, and ECU functions.
NOTE:
- The power window control system uses a multiplex communication system (LIN). Inspect the communication function by following HOW TO PROCEED WITH TROUBLESHOOTING. Troubleshoot the power window control system after confirming that the communication system is functioning properly.
- When the power window regulator motor assembly (on the driver side) is reinstalled or replaced, the power window control system must be initialized.
- After a door glass or a door glass run has been replaced, the jam protection function may operate unexpectedly when the AUTO UP function is used. In such cases, the AUTO UP function can be resumed by repeating the following operation at least 5 times:
- Close the power window by fully pulling up the power window switch and holding it at the AUTO UP position.
- Open the power window by fully pushing down the switch.
- When the ECU determines that the driver door power window regulator motor has a malfunction, DTC B2311 is set.
HINT:
If the pulse sensor built into the power window regulator motor (on the driver side) malfunctions, the power window control system enters fail-safe mode. The remote UP / DOWN and AUTO UP / DOWN functions cannot be operated during fail-safe mode. (However, the power window can be closed by holding the power window switch in the AUTO UP position, and opened manually by pushing down the switch.)
